通过重尾噪声控制,提升SGD避开尖锐极小值的能力

Global Dynamics of Heavy-Tailed SGDs in Nonconvex Loss Landscape: Characterization and Control

  • 引入重尾噪声并截断,改变SGD全局动态行为
  • 实验验证该方法使模型收敛到更平坦的极小值点
  • 适合关注模型泛化性能与优化机制的研究者

随机梯度下降(SGD)及其变体推动了现代人工智能发展,但其理论理解远落后于实际应用。普遍认为SGD能避免损失曲面中与较差泛化性相关的尖锐局部极小值。为揭示这一现象并进一步增强其能力,必须突破传统局部收敛分析,全面理解SGD的全局动力学。本文基于Wang和Rhee(2023)的大型偏差与亚稳态分析,构建了一套技术工具,精确刻画了重尾SGD的全局动态。特别地,我们发现深度学习中一个有趣现象:在训练过程中注入并随后截断重尾噪声,可几乎完全避免尖锐极小值,从而提升测试数据上的泛化性能。模拟与深度学习实验均证实,采用梯度裁剪的重尾SGD能找到几何更平坦的局部极小值,并实现更优泛化表现。

Stochastic gradient descent (SGD) and its variants enable modern artificial intelligence. However, theoretical understanding lags far behind their empirical success. It is widely believed that SGD has a curious ability to avoid sharp local minima in the loss landscape, which are associated with poor generalization. To unravel this mystery and further enhance such capability of SGDs, it is imperative to go beyond the traditional local convergence analysis and obtain a comprehensive understanding of SGDs' global dynamics. In this paper, we develop a set of technical machinery based on the recent large deviations and metastability analysis in Wang and Rhee (2023) and obtain sharp characterization of the global dynamics of heavy-tailed SGDs. In particular, we reveal a fascinating phenomenon in deep learning: by injecting and then truncating heavy-tailed noises during the training phase, SGD can almost completely avoid sharp minima and achieve better generalization performance for the test data. Simulation and deep learning experiments confirm our theoretical prediction that heavy-tailed SGD with gradient clipping finds local minima with a more flat geometry and achieves better generalization performance.
